Calculus 4

Calculus 4 is an advanced level course in calculus that builds upon the concepts covered in Calculus 1, 2 and 3. Calculus. Calculus is one of the most important branches of mathematics that deals with rate of change and motion. The two major concepts that calculus is based on are derivatives and integrals. Thus, one of the most common ways to use calculus is to set up an equation containing an unknown function y = f (x) y = f (x) and its derivative, known as a differential equation.Solving such equations often provides information …This course covers vector and multi-variable calculus. It is the second semester in the freshman calculus sequence. Topics include vectors and matrices, partial derivatives, double and triple integrals, and vector calculus in 2 and 3-space.
